- The distance between Mt Makulu, Zambia and Oran, Algeria is approximately 6,451 km or 4,009 mi.
- To reach Mt Makulu in this distance one would set out from Oran bearing 146.8° or SSE and follow the great circles arc to approach Mt Makulu bearing 152.5° or SSE .
- Mt Makulu has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a) whereas Oran has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- Mt Makulu is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ome whereas Oran is in or near the subtropical thorn woodland biome.
- The annual average temperature is 2.7 °C (4.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6 °C (10.8°F) less in Mt Makulu.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 486.5 mm (19.2 in) more which is equivalent to 486.5 l/m² (11.94 US gal/ft²) or 4,865,000 l/ha (520,101 US gal/ac) more. About 2 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 16.3° higher in Mt Makulu than in Oran.
- Relative humidity levels are 17.2%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 1.6°C (2.8°F) lower.
